Key points to note: If you earn £100,000 or more, your Personal Allowance is reduced by £1 for every £2 earned over this amount.; Those earning above £125,140 will lose their Personal Allowance entirely.; The tax bands remain unchanged from the 2024-2025 tax year.; Scotland's Income Tax System

Tax rates on dividend income: Basic rate 8.75% 8.75% Higher rate 33.75% 33.75% Additional rate 39.35% 39.35% Trusts: Income exemption generally £500 £500 Rate applicable to trusts: Dividends 39.35% 39.35% Scotland has a different tax system, with five income tax bands rather than three.
